- [ ] **Step 7: Breaker override escrow.** After sealing the signing keys for the Tallgrove upstream API circuit breaker, confirm the support team can force the breaker open during a full outage. The override bundle lives in the sealed escrow drawer and is useless without its unlock phrase. Two ceremony witnesses must initial this step before proceeding. The escrow bundle is decrypted with the recovery passphrase that follows.

vault phrase of kahip-kahop = holath-quenmir

TICKET: PoolDrift exhausts connections under burst load

Priority: High. The Quillbase pooler leaks handles when a checkout times out mid-transaction; idle reaper never reclaims them. Repro: 200 concurrent writers, 5s timeout. Fix lands in the pooler branch with a watchdog that force-closes orphaned handles. Maintainers: do not bump max_pool as a workaround; it masks the leak. Verified against the build identified below.

session token of taduf-tahog = htk4_91a1

Subject: Second-source supplier search — status

Board,

Search for a second source on the Harlane valve assembly is underway. Three candidates shortlisted; site assessments complete by month-end. Target: dual-sourcing within two quarters, capping single-supplier exposure at sixty percent. Costs within approved envelope. The strategic context is set out in the note below.

management briefing: Jorixax Holdings is in early talks to buy Casixax Holdings for about $420.3 million. The Fenmir launch date is October 27, and nothing goes to the press before then. Legal wants the Keloxek Foods term sheet redrafted before April 16.

## Changelog — Font vendoring defaults changed

As of this release, the Bracken UI build no longer fetches third-party fonts at build time. All typefaces used by the Lanternwell suite are now vendored into the repo under a dedicated assets directory, and the fetch step is skipped by default. If you're onboarding, nothing to install — the fonts travel with the checkout. The build flags controlling this behavior are listed below.

settings of hadup-yafog:
LAMAEL_PIN=3761
LAMAEL_TENANT=istmir
LAMAEL_METRICS_HOST=metrics.lamael.plorvasys.test
LAMAEL_SEAL=seal_8ea68500
LAMAEL_STANDBY_TEAM=fraok